WARNING: The following article contains minor potential SPOILERS for Deltarune Chapter 4.Deltarune creator Toby Fox hid a clever reference to another hit indie title, Innersloth's Among Us, in the recently released Chapters 3 and 4 update across all platforms. After finding this special Easter egg in Deltarune, the Among Us social media team sent an excited reply to Toby Fox, who responded with a joke of his own.
Billed as a parallel story to Undertale, Deltarune has seen periodic updates since its initial launch in 2018. Using a chapter-based format to tell its overarching story, Deltarune recently doubled its available chapters from two to four following the launch of Nintendo's new Switch 2 console. The Switch 2 version of Deltarune features functions that utilize the mouse mode capabilities of the Joy-Con 2 controllers. However, this Joy-Con feature can only be used in a specific room that players must find. Game creator Toby Fox also stated that the newly released Chapter 4 is not the end of Deltarune, as the game's fifth chapter is planned to arrive sometime in 2026.
